Regular Circuit Breaker Interruptions
Frequent trips of the circuit breaker can point to underlying power problems that need expert care. This repeated issue may suggest an overloaded circuit, where multiple devices consume electricity at the same time, overloading the electrical system. Furthermore, faulty wiring or broken wiring can cause shorts, making the breaker to trip as a safety precaution. Sometimes, a malfunctioning breaker itself may be the cause, necessitating replacement. Homeowners should also keep in mind that outdated electrical panels might not be able to handle today's power demands effectively, creating safety hazards. Ignoring these signs can lead to more significant dangers, including electrical fires. Consulting a qualified electrician guarantees these issues are properly diagnosed and fixed, restoring safety and dependability to the home's electrical system.
Lighting that Blink Or Reduce in brightness
Flickering or dimming lights are often a sign of underlying electrical issues that require expert assessment. These signs can indicate disconnected wiring, which may result in further complications if not handled promptly. Additionally, an overstretched electrical circuit can cause lights to fluctuate, indicating that the power system is struggling to meet the load. In some cases, a broken light fixture or bulb may be the culprit, but it is essential to rule out more serious issues. Homeowners should not overlook these signs, as they can result in electrical hazards. Engaging a certified electrical professional guarantees a thorough diagnosis and safe resolution, allowing for a dependable and consistent lighting environment. Prompt action can prevent potential safety risks and expensive fixes.
Outdated Wiring Systems
Worn electrical systems can generate substantial safety hazards, as they typically do not meet contemporary electrical demands. Properties with antiquated wiring may face blackout events, light flickering, or even electrical fires caused by excess heat. Such installations might feature aluminum wiring or aged breaker boxes, which cannot manage the power demand of modern devices and equipment. Furthermore, aging systems may be deficient in grounding, increasing the likelihood of electrocution or shock. Homeowners should monitor for warning indicators, including compromised wires or recurrent breaker trips of circuit breakers. Contracting a skilled electrician is crucial for analyzing the structural integrity of the wiring and guaranteeing that safety codes are achieved, ultimately protecting both the structure and its inhabitants.

Cost Elements for Working with Electricians
What considerations influence the cost of hiring an electrician? Multiple factors are essential in establishing the total cost. First, the difficulty of the job greatly affects rates; intricate work such as rewiring or implementing new installations generally necessitate more labor hours and expertise. Additionally, location may shape pricing, as cities typically see elevated labor charges versus countryside areas. The electrician's background and certifications also contribute to rates; see the full story more veteran specialists often charge higher rates due to their advanced expertise.
The materials and equipment needed for a undertaking further add to the total cost, especially if high-quality or specialized items are necessary. Furthermore, the season can influence availability and rates, with busy periods occasionally causing higher prices. Property owners should take into account these factors and secure multiple quotes to ensure they get reliable service at a fair cost.

What Should I Do When Experiencing an Electrical Emergency?
During an electrical crisis, you should immediately turn off the power at the circuit breaker, avoid using water, and refrain from touching downed wires. Subsequently, contact a qualified electrician for assistance and safety evaluation.
